Output efb8f4a3985dc6e2cffe9c573099bd2913c5f86a4c65197bcf7c69a6469fc5e4:1

value
66124075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41aa4d99f23d5f20220b7cd8d99108562587b9a8 OP_EQUAL
address
37gDrt6BXZWF9MhvT3rDFs7UjmY3pbSP5N
transaction
efb8f4a3985dc6e2cffe9c573099bd2913c5f86a4c65197bcf7c69a6469fc5e4
confirmations
291449
spent
true